Understanding the Requirements: Who Needs a Polish License?
Before starting the process, drivers must figure out where they stand lawfully. Poland has different guidelines depending upon the candidate's native land and Uzyskaj Polskie Prawo Jazdy the kind of visa or residence allow they hold.
- EU/EEA License Holders: Individuals holding a chauffeur's license provided by an EU or EEA member state can legally drive in Poland using their current license until it ends. They are not needed to exchange it, though they can pick to do so willingly.
- Non-EU License Holders (Vienna Convention): Those with a license from a nation that signed the 1968 Vienna Convention on Road Traffic can drive on their foreign license for as much as 185 days after residing in Poland. After this period, they must exchange it for a Polish license.
- Other Non-EU License Holders: Individuals from countries not part of the Vienna Convention (or those without a global driving license translation) usually can not exchange their license directly. They must go through the standard Polish training and testing process from the start.
Action 1: Getting a PKK Number (Profil Kandydata na Kierowcę)
No matter if an applicant is exchanging a license or taking tests from scratch, the very primary step is acquiring a PKK (Driver Candidate Profile) number. This is a distinct electronic file that tracks all stages of obtaining a driver's license in Poland.
To get a PKK, candidates should visit their local district office (Urząd Dzielnicy or Starostwo Powiatowe) and submit the following documents:
- A completed application.
- A valid ID (passport and residence card/visa).
- Verification of legal home in Poland (meldunek or a certificate showing a minimum of 185 days of residency).
- A current passport-sized photo (3.5 x 4.5 cm).
- A medical certificate verifying no health contraindications to driving.
- The existing foreign motorist's license (if appropriate) in addition to a sworn Polish translation.

Step 3: Training and Exams (For New Drivers)
For those who can not exchange their foreign license and needs to start from scratch, or for those finding out to drive for the very first time, enrolling in a state-approved driving school (Informacje O Polskim Prawie Jazdyśrodek Szkolenia Kierowców or OSK) is necessary.
Standard Training Requirements (Category B)
- Theory: Minimum 30 hours of classroom direction (however numerous schools provide online alternatives). Passing the state theory test is needed before useful training can be completed.
- Practice: Minimum 30 hours behind-the-wheel driving guideline with a licensed instructor.
Once training is total, prospects need to pass 2 state tests at the Voivodeship Road Traffic Center (WORD):
- The Theoretical Exam: A computer-based test covering traffic rules, road signs, and danger perception. It is offered in Polish, English, and German in most significant cities.

Once the exams are passed (or the exchange application is effectively processed by the workplace), the status of the chauffeur's license can be tracked online via the main government website, obywatel.gov.pl.
- Processing Time: It typically takes in between 2 to 4 weeks for the physical card to be printed and provided to the local workplace.
- Pickup: Applicants will get a notice (or can examine online) that the document is all set. They should bring their ID and evidence of payment to gather the physical card.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I take the theoretical driving examination in English?
Yes. Major WORD centers across Poland (such as in Warsaw, Kraków, Wrocław, and Poznań) offer the theoretical exam in English and German. Some centers might also use Russian or Ukrainian depending upon regional demand.
2. What happens to my original foreign motorist's license if I exchange it?
When you exchange a non-EU motorist's license for a Polish one, the Polish authorities will keep your original foreign document. They are legally required to send it back to the issuing authority in your house country. If you go back to your home country completely, you can typically use to obtain it.

4. The length of time is a Polish motorist's license valid?
For Category B (standard cars), licenses are normally provided for a period of 15 years, aligning with the validity of the medical certificate provided. Motorists with particular health conditions or those holding expert classifications (C, D) might have shorter credibility periods.
